How they compare

Qatar currently reports 92.6% against 88.2% in SDG: Eastern and South-eastern Asia, a difference of 4.4%.

That makes Qatar's figure about 1.1 times SDG: Eastern and South-eastern Asia's.

Across all 25 years both countries report, Qatar has been ahead every year.

Qatar ranks 65th and SDG: Eastern and South-eastern Asia ranks 68th of 186 countries.

Qatar has averaged higher in every one of the 4 decades both report.

Head to head by decade

Decade Qatar SDG: Eastern and South-eastern Asia Difference Ahead
1990s 87.9% 63.5% 24.5% Qatar
2000s 83.3% 67.0% 16.2% Qatar
2010s 88.5% 78.3% 10.1% Qatar
2020s 92.7% 86.5% 6.2% Qatar

Averages of every year both report within each decade.
